Sajith joined NREL in 2020 and works in the Building Energy Science Group as a post-doctoral researcher. He works on whole-building energy simulations with a focus on implementing thermal energy storage and grid flexibility strategies. Sajith also works on modeling studies to increase the building energy resilience against different weather situations.
